Collins
we ★★★★★
/wɪ, STRONG wiː/
We is the first person plural pronoun. We is used as the subject of a verb. we是第一人称复数代词,用作动词的主语。
1
[PRON-PLURAL 复数型代词](包括说话者或笔者在内的)我们 A speaker or writer uses we to refer both to himself or herself and to one or more other people as a group. You can use we before a noun to make it clear which group of people you are referring to.
  • We both swore we'd be friends ever after...

    我俩都发誓从此以后永远是朋友。

  • We ordered another bottle of champagne...

    我们又点了一瓶香槟。

  • Don't you think we should ask this young man some technical questions?...

    你不觉得我们应该向这位年轻人请教几个技术问题吗?

  • We students outnumbered our teachers.

    我们学生的人数比老师多。

2
[PRON-PLURAL 复数型代词](泛指)人们,我们每个人 We is sometimes used to refer to people in general.
  • We need to take care of our bodies.

    我们需要注意身体。

  • ...the withdrawal symptoms that we all experience at the end of a long, close relationship.

    在一段长期的亲密感情结束时大家都会体会到的难以割舍的痛苦

3
[PRON-PLURAL 复数型代词](不仅指自己也指听者或读者)我们 A speaker or writer may use we instead of 'I' in order to include the audience or reader in what they are saying, especially when discussing how a talk or book is organized.
  [FORMAL 正式]
  • We will now consider the raw materials from which the body derives energy.

    现在我们来细想一下为身体提供能量的原料。

LDC
wewe /wi; strong wiː/ ●●● S1 W1 pronoun [used as the subject of a verb]
Word Origin
Examples
Collocations
Phrases
1used by the person speaking or writing to refer to himself or herself and one or more other people:  ‘Did you go into the supermarket?’ ‘No, we didn’t.’ Shall we stop for a coffee? So we all travelled down to Brighton together. We declare our support for a government of national unity. We Italians are proud of our history.2used by a writer or speaker to include themselves and their readers or listeners:  As we saw in Chapter 4, slavery was not the only cause of the Civil War.3people in general:  We live on a complex planet.4formal used by a king or queen to refer to himself or herself5 spoken sometimes used to mean ‘you’ when speaking to children or people who are ill:  How are we feeling today, Mr Robson?
